Hey Support crew — Darla handing off to Renz here. Quick note on the SQL linting rules for the Quellbok pipeline: we enforce lowercase keywords, mandatory table aliases, and a 120-char line cap. If a customer's migration file fails CI, it's almost always the alias rule. The linter reads its settings from the service config, not the repo. For reference, here are the current values.

deployment values, yadup-kadug:
[sorys]
port = 5672
team = noveth
host = sorys.orvexcorp.example
region = south-4
access_code = ac_deddc1
timeout_ms = 1500

# Session Handling — Reconciliation Job

The Tallyhook inventory reconciliation job authenticates once per run rather than per request. At startup it opens a session against the Cratewise API, and the session persists for the full sweep, typically 40 minutes. Sessions auto-expire after 90 minutes of inactivity; the job renews them if a sweep runs long. Do not share sessions across concurrent runs — each worker must open its own. For local testing against the sandbox environment, authenticate your session using the token below.

session JWT of yawep-yawep = eyJhbGciOiJIUzI1NiIsInR5cCI6IkpXVCJ9.eyJzdWIiOiI3pWF3_In0.aXYsHiog

Action item from the Driftline outage review: webhook delivery in Pulsegate currently retries on any non-2xx, including 4xx, which hammered partner endpoints for six hours. Fix: retry only on 5xx and timeouts, with exponential backoff capped at 30 minutes and a dead-letter queue after eight attempts. Owner: delivery pod. Due end of sprint. New folks: read the retry semantics spec before touching this code. Full details are on the internal wiki page.

dashboard of bahaf-tageg = https://jira.zemvarlabs.internal/projects/projects/browse/projects

**Runbook: Account Recovery — Profile Store Sharding (Meridock)**

When recovering a locked account on the Lanterel profile store, first confirm which shard owns the user record; the hash ring split last quarter means shard maps older than v14 are stale. Rehydrate the profile from the shard-local snapshot, not the global backup, or you will resurrect pre-split duplicates. Verify the email token flow end to end before closing. To unseal the recovery vault, use the passphrase below.

strongbox words: eliath-quenix-praiel